Abstract
People have developed great demands for online shopping recently, but shopping online has information asymmetry and privacy issues. So third party payment is born to solve theses problems. In definition, third party payment is a neutral institution with technical and credit ability that transfers money from one to another. In fact, developed countries have legislated to deal with this new business in the past ten years. Though Taiwan is in his initial stage for third party payment, the law for third payment is implemented in May 2015. Competition between third party payment institutions and banks is inevitable. Third party payment business has been mature in China. Due to environment of china is similar to environment of Taiwan, this study analyzes the competition between banks and third party payment institutions by learning from China’s experience. After the analytics, this study gives suggestion for banks’ strategy making in the future.
